How To Fix Error Unable To Request Shsh On 3utools When Top
Sometimes your device is in a "stuck" recovery state that confuses 3uTools. Exiting and re-entering recovery mode resets the USB communication.
Steps:
When you tick "Top" next to an iOS version in 3uTools, you are asking the software to automatically select the highest available iOS version that is still being signed by Apple for your device. Ironically, attempting to flash the "Top" version often triggers this error because:
Do not trust that "Top" means available. Apple can stop signing a version within hours.
Steps:
If you want, specify your device model, iOS version, and whether you're on Windows or Mac and I’ll provide tailored steps.
(function:RelatedSearchTerms) ["suggestions":["suggestion":"3uTools unable to request SHSH fix","score":0.9,"suggestion":"how to get SHSH blobs 3uTools stuck","score":0.75,"suggestion":"Apple Mobile Device Support reinstall guide","score":0.6]]
The "Unable to request SHSH" error in 3uTools typically occurs at the 9% mark during a flash or restore process. It usually means the software cannot communicate with Apple's signing servers to verify the firmware version you are trying to install. Common Fixes
Update 3uTools: This is the most successful solution. Older versions of 3uTools may have bugs or outdated server links that prevent SHSH requests. Visit the official 3uTools Download Page to get the latest version.
Check iOS Signing Status: Apple only "signs" certain firmware versions (usually the most recent). If you are trying to downgrade to an older, unsigned version, 3uTools will fail because Apple's servers are no longer authorizing those installs. You can check current signing status at IPSW.me. how to fix error unable to request shsh on 3utools when top
Switch to "iTunes Flash" Mode: Some users on Reddit found that switching from "Easy Flash" to the "iTunes Flash" tab within 3uTools bypasses this specific bug.
Verify Your Network: Ensure your computer has a stable internet connection. Firewall or antivirus settings can sometimes block the request to gs.apple.com (Apple's signing server).
Hardware Check: If the error persists or occurs at different percentages (like 19% or 20%), it may indicate a hardware issue with the device's NAND (storage) chip. Summary Table: Troubleshooting Steps Why it works 1 Update 3uTools Fixes internal software bugs and server communication. 2 Verify Signing Ensures Apple still allows the iOS version you chose. 3 Change Flash Mode
"iTunes Flash" often has better compatibility than "Easy Flash". 4 Check Cable/USB A faulty connection can drop the request mid-process.
Are you trying to downgrade to a specific version, or just performing a standard update? How to Fix 3uTools 9% ERROR Unable to request SHSH Latest
How to Fix the “Unable to Request SHSH” Error on 3uTools When on Top Firmware
The “Unable to request SHSH” error in 3uTools is a common frustration for iOS users trying to save or use SHSH blobs, especially when their device is running the latest (top) firmware version. This error typically arises because Apple has stopped signing the firmware you are trying to request, or because 3uTools itself is struggling to communicate with Apple’s signing servers. Since you cannot downgrade to an unsigned firmware without saved blobs, the solution requires a change in strategy rather than brute force. Here are the most effective fixes.
1. Understand the Signing Window Constraint The most frequent cause of this error is simple: Apple is no longer signing the iOS version you are requesting. When a device is on the “top” (newest public) firmware, Apple often stops signing the previous version within days or weeks. 3uTools will return “Unable to request SHSH” because no valid signature exists for that iOS build. Before any troubleshooting, verify current signing status on sites like ipsw.me. If the firmware is unsigned, you cannot request SHSH blobs for it—period. Your only option is to save blobs for the currently signed top version for future use.
2. Switch to Manual Request Mode 3uTools’ automatic SHSH fetch often fails with the top firmware due to server timeouts or cached data. To bypass this: Sometimes your device is in a "stuck" recovery
3. Use an Alternative Server or Tool 3uTools may have outdated or overloaded proxy servers. Switch the SHSH server:
4. Disable Antivirus and Firewall Temporarily Security software can block 3uTools’ ability to reach Apple’s servers, especially on top firmware where network handshakes are strict. Temporarily disable Windows Defender or any third-party firewall, then retry the SHSH request. If it works, add 3uTools to your antivirus whitelist.
5. Reinstall or Update 3uTools An outdated 3uTools client may have broken API endpoints. Uninstall, then download the latest version from the official site. Older builds often fail to request blobs for new iOS versions because Apple changes its TSS protocol. A fresh install resets corrupted configuration files.
6. Last Resort: Fetch via Jailbreak (If Available) If your top firmware is jailbreakable, use a tool like System Info (from Cydia/Taurine) or Blobsaver on a PC. These utilities can dump the device’s current APNonce and request blobs while the device is running, bypassing 3uTools’ generic request method.
Conclusion The “Unable to request SHSH” error on top firmware usually signals either an unsigned iOS version, a server communication issue, or a tool limitation. The most reliable fix is to verify signing status, switch to manual request mode, or use a dedicated web-based saver like TSS Saver. Avoid relying solely on 3uTools for critical blob saving—always cross-check with alternative methods. By understanding that Apple’s signing window is the ultimate gatekeeper, you can stop chasing a dead end and focus on saving blobs for the currently signed version while you still can.
The air in the room was thick with the hum of a desktop fan as Alex stared at the screen. The progress bar for the iPhone flash was stuck at exactly 9% . Below it, a cold, red message flashed: "Error: Unable to request SHSH"
Alex had done this a dozen times, but this time, the digital handshake between the phone and Apple's servers had failed. Here is how Alex navigated the technical maze to fix it: 1. The Update Shortcut
Alex realized the version of 3uTools being used might be the culprit. Sometimes, older versions simply lose the ability to talk to newer Apple authentication protocols. Alex visited the official 3uTools website
and downloaded the latest version. In many cases, a simple software update resolves the 9% hang immediately. 2. The Signature Check How to Fix the “Unable to Request SHSH”
Alex remembered that Apple only "signs" certain firmware versions. If Alex was trying to downgrade to an iOS version that Apple had already "closed," the SHSH request would always fail because the server refused to provide the necessary digital key. Alex checked a site like
or used the "Query Compatible" button in 3uTools to ensure the firmware was still being signed by Apple. 3. The Network Barrier
A flickering Wi-Fi connection or a strict firewall can block the SHSH request.
Alex swapped the USB cable for an original Apple one and switched to a stable, wired internet connection to ensure the request reached Apple’s servers without interruption. 4. The Advanced "SHSH Host" Method When "Easy Flash" failed, Alex took a more manual route. How to Fix 3uTools 9% ERROR Unable to request SHSH Latest
This tutorial assumes you’re using 3uTools to save SHSH blobs or perform operations and you see an error like “unable to request SHSH” (or similar) while the device is at the Apple logo / stuck on “Top” / boot loop. Follow these steps in order — each step is concise and prescriptive.
If you are an iOS enthusiast who enjoys downgrading firmware, jailbreaking, or restoring legacy devices, you have likely used 3uTools. It is one of the most powerful third-party tools for managing iPhones and iPads on Windows. However, a common roadblock that stops users in their tracks is the dreaded error message:
"Unable to request SHSH"
This error typically appears when you tick the "Top" version option (or try to fetch SHSH blobs) in the "Flash & JB" section. When this happens, the process stops immediately, and your device may be stuck in recovery mode.
This article will explain why this error occurs, what "Top" means in 3uTools, and provide eight proven solutions to fix it permanently.